Compounds of formula (I), wherein R and R1 are H or C¿1?-C4 alkyl; and X is a group of formulae (II) or (III), wherein either R?2¿ is H or C¿1?-C4 alkyl and R?3 is C¿1-C4 alkyl, or R?2 and R3¿ represent -(CH¿2?)r- wherein r is from 2 to 5; R?4 is C¿1-C4 alkyl; X1 is a direct link, O or S; R5 is mono or disubstituted phenyl wherein the substituents are H, halo, C¿1?-C4 alkyl, C1-C4 alkoxy, -(CH2)sOH, -(CH2)sNR?8R9, -CONR10R11, -SO¿2NH2 or -OCO(C1-C4 alkyl), or adjacent substituents may form a fused ring; or R5 is thienyl, pyridinyl or pyrazinyl; R?8 and R9¿ are H or C¿1?-C4 alkyl, or R?8¿ is hydrogen and R9 is -SO¿2?(C1-C4 alkyl), -CONR?10R11¿, -CO(C¿1?-C4 alkyl) or -SO2NH2; R?10 and R11¿ are hydrogen or C¿1?-C4 alkyl; m is 1, 2 or 3; n is 0, 1 or 2; p is 0 or 1; and s is 0, 1 or 2, (with certain provisos); are gastrointestinal and bladder selective muscarinic receptor antagonists of utility for example in irritable bowel syndrome. |
